I was really enjoying this movie, and the fact that it was mostly light on using callbacks and references to the other stories as a crutch.
It was a cool use of the world to tell an original story.
Then Depp turned up, brought in grendelwald, tethered the whole thing to the main saga, opened up all of the previously noted continuity problems, and nearly ruined it.
I can see just the damn army of character returns, parents, and references just piling on in the future movies.
The incredibly small world created by all of the interconnected relationships and families is one of the few problems I have with the original story. Going to America and doing this whole new story, or using Newt as a catalyst for MOW type movies would expand the universe and retcon the whole scope back to a grand scale.
Instead we're right back where we started for the most part.
Should have known Rowling couldn't leave well enough alone.
